46RH to 47RH differences
Neighbor has a 1994 halfton 360 Auto 4x4. Trans is completely toast barely moves forward no reverse gears. He is wanting me to either buy it from him or fix it for him. I can get a rebuild kit for $250 and have serviced AG powershift transmissions so I feel I have the ability to do it but wondering if I could swap in a decent 47RH I have at my house already.
The 47RH is removed from a 95 2500 4x4 V10. What all will be needed to do the swap if its even possible? I have access to the complete V10 truck if I need to parts off the V10 motor. |
To my understanding, the case of the 47RH will not bolt-up to a 5.9/360 gas motor, however, I believe some of the internal parts from the 47RH can be used inside a 46RH to make it stronger, such as the planetaries, drums, shaft, etc.
|
Bellhousing is bigger and about 4" longer externally...
That already sets you back a custom adapter plate ($1000+), starter, flywheel, and custom driveshafts :D Jake |
